Transaction 4667aea282dfea19756c825fef860fc4bb2e40d8e97cb26882554717c59e4ec8

1 Input
2 Outputs
  • 4667aea282dfea19756c825fef860fc4bb2e40d8e97cb26882554717c59e4ec8:0
  • value  313420
    address  2MstKStWogknCXm6gUHLU9C2hicZMbDUqSu
  • 4667aea282dfea19756c825fef860fc4bb2e40d8e97cb26882554717c59e4ec8:1
  • value  7899453855
    address  2Mzk3fPxjzz8oxYZ9pwpALBWSAoPDBSA51t